Tüm bulutlarda çalışan açık kaynaklı programlama dili Winglang’ın arkasındaki şirket olan Wing Cloud, geliştiricilerin konteynerli uygulamalarını yerel olarak oluşturmasına ve test etmesine olanak tanıyan ‘Wing Simulator’ ile konteyner desteğini geliştiriyor.
Wing Simulator, zaman alıcı ve pahalı olan hazırlık ortamlarına, karmaşık konfigürasyonlara ve uzaktan hata ayıklamaya gerek kalmadan yerel ve üretim öncesi testlere olanak tanır. Üretimde aynı uygulama tanımı daha sonra üretime hazır bir Helm grafiğinde derlenebilir ve bir Kubernetes kümesine dağıtılabilir.
“Kubernetes güçlü bir üretim aracıdır ancak geliştirme söz konusu olduğunda karmaşıklığı haklı gösterilemez. Geliştiriciler, konteynerlerini bulut sistemleri bağlamında yerel olarak çalıştırabilmek istiyor. Geliştiriciler, Winglang’dan yararlanarak konteynere alınmış uygulamalarını daha büyük sistem bağlamında tanımlayabilir, Wing Simulator içinde çalıştırabilir ve ardından bunları Helm ve Terraform kullanarak üretim ortamlarına dağıtabilirler,” dedi Elad Ben-Israel, CEO ve Kurucu Ortak Kanat Bulutu.
Ben-Israel, “Kubernetes kullanmayı seçen geliştiricilere, herhangi bir Kubernetes uzmanlığına veya kümeye ihtiyaç duymadan konteynerli hizmetleri yerel makinelerinde test etme olanağı vererek Wing Simulator ile üretkenliklerini 10 kat artırıyoruz” diye ekledi.
Datadog’un 9 Gerçek Dünya Konteyner Kullanımı Araştırmasına göre Kubernetes, konteyner kuruluşlarının neredeyse yarısının büyüyen bir ekosistemde konteynerleri dağıtmak ve yönetmek için Kubernetes çalıştırmasıyla her zamankinden daha popüler. Aynı rapor, sunucusuz teknolojinin de yükselişte olduğunu belirterek, bu popüler teknolojilerin her ikisini de kapsayabilecek bir programlama modeline olan ihtiyacın altını çiziyor.
Winglang, birinci sınıf vatandaşlar olarak bulut kaynaklarından yararlanan dağıtılmış sistemler oluşturmak için tasarlanmış açık kaynaklı bir programlama dilidir. Winglang derleyicisi; Terraform, CloudFormation, Helm veya diğer bulut sağlama motorları için kod olarak altyapı tanımlarını; AWS Lambda, Kubernetes gibi bilgi işlem platformlarında veya uç platformlarda çalışacak şekilde tasarlanmış Node.js kodunun yanı sıra.
Geliştiriciler Winglang’da konteyner tabanlı uygulamalar oluştururken artık uygulamayı üretime dağıtmak zorunda kalmadan uygulamanın mimarisi ve geliştirme ortamından veri akışıyla etkileşim kurmak için Wing Simulator’dan yararlanabilirler. Bu, geliştirme döngülerinde büyük miktarda zaman ve para tasarrufu sağlar ve hantal geliştirme kümelerine ve hata ayıklama araçlarına olan ihtiyacı ortadan kaldırır.
Wing Simulator, uygulama tanımına göre yerel Docker konteynerlerini düzenler ve bunları diğer simüle edilmiş bulut kaynaklarına sorunsuz bir şekilde bağlayarak geliştiricilere tüm bulut uygulamalarının yerel simülasyonunu sağlar ve herhangi bir şey dağıtmaya gerek kalmadan uçtan uca hızlı geliştirme ve testlere olanak tanır. buluta veya Kubernetes kümesine.
Datadog Başkanı Amit Agarwal, “Wing Cloud konusunda çok heyecanlıyım çünkü geliştiricilerin hem temel bulut altyapısını soyutlayarak hem de ihtiyaç duyduklarında belirli bulut sağlayıcılarının teknik özelliklerinden faydalanmalarını zarif bir şekilde bir araya getiriyor” dedi.
Wing Cloud, Battery Ventures, Grove Ventures ve StageOne Ventures liderliğindeki 20 milyon dolarlık tohum finansmanıyla Temmuz ayında gizlice piyasaya sürüldü; Secret Chord Ventures, Cerca Partners ve Operator Partners’ın katılımıyla. Melek yatırımcılar arasında Datadog Başkanı Amit Agarwal; Armon Dadgar, HashiCorp’un Kurucu Ortağı ve CTO’su; Benny Schnaider, Salto’nun Kurucu Ortağı; Stedi’nin Kurucusu Zack Kanter; ve diğer endüstri liderleri.